25.100 ROAD CROSSINGS AT GRADE

1. Providing Crossing Protection
a) Freeland and Mershon Passing Sidings - Due to rusty rail conditions, trains and engines must approach automatic grade crossing protection prepared to stop and must not foul crossings unless the automatic grade crossing warning devices are operating properly or crossings are protected by a crew member on the ground at the crossing.

1. Weigh-in-Motion Scale - is located in No. 3 track and is certified to weigh:
Pulling west to east
Shoving west to east
Speed lights located 1,000 feet east and west of the scale on the south side of No. 3 track, display the following aspects and indications:

SpeedDisplayIndication
0.1 MPH-4.0 MPH Continuous Yellow Scale weighing
4.1 MPH-4.5 MPH Flashing Yellow Scale weighing,
approaching
critical speed
4.6 MPH and above Lights Out Scale shutdown
account over
speed

In the event the scale should shutdown account overspeed, stop must be made and Dean Yard Office contacted immediately. Reweighing will be required.
